
车辆感知与定位算法-深度研究.pptx
35页车辆感知与定位算法,车辆感知算法概述 定位算法原理分析 感知与定位技术融合 算法性能优化策略 实时数据处理方法 数据融合算法研究 定位精度影响因素 智能交通应用前景,Contents Page,目录页,车辆感知算法概述,车辆感知与定位算法,车辆感知算法概述,多传感器融合技术在车辆感知中的应用,1.融合多种传感器数据,如雷达、摄像头、激光雷达等,以实现更全面的环境感知2.通过算法优化,提高传感器数据的互补性和一致性,减少单一传感器在恶劣环境下的局限性3.研究趋势显示,深度学习等人工智能技术在多传感器融合中的应用正日益增多,提升了感知的准确性和实时性基于机器学习的车辆目标检测与识别,1.利用机器学习算法,尤其是深度学习,对车辆进行高精度检测和识别2.通过大量标注数据训练模型,提高目标检测的准确率和召回率3.研究前沿包括使用更复杂的网络结构,如Transformer,以处理复杂的场景和动态环境车辆感知算法概述,环境建模与理解,1.通过传感器数据构建车辆周围环境的三维模型,实现对道路、交通标志、行人等的精确识别2.环境理解算法需具备对复杂场景的适应能力,如识别不同天气、光照条件下的环境变化3.结合SLAM(同步定位与地图构建)技术,实现动态环境的持续更新和精确定位。
车辆定位与导航,1.利用GPS、IMU(惯性测量单元)等多源数据,结合地图匹配算法,实现车辆的精确定位2.导航算法需在实时性和准确性之间取得平衡,以满足自动驾驶对定位的严格要求3.前沿技术如基于视觉的定位方法在室内或信号遮挡环境下展现出巨大潜力车辆感知算法概述,决策与控制策略,1.基于感知到的环境和车辆状态,制定合理的决策策略,如路径规划、速度控制等2.控制策略需考虑动态环境中的不确定性,如其他车辆和行人的行为预测3.研究方向包括强化学习等先进控制方法,以提高决策的鲁棒性和适应性安全性与可靠性,1.在车辆感知算法中融入安全机制,如冗余设计和错误检测,确保算法的可靠性2.通过仿真和实际道路测试,验证算法在复杂环境下的安全性和稳定性3.随着自动驾驶技术的发展,对车辆感知算法的安全性和可靠性要求越来越高,成为研究的重要方向定位算法原理分析,车辆感知与定位算法,定位算法原理分析,定位算法的概述,1.定位算法是车辆感知与定位技术中的核心部分,它通过分析传感器数据来确定车辆在环境中的位置2.定位算法的发展经历了从单一传感器到多传感器融合的过程,提高了定位的精度和可靠性3.随着自动驾驶技术的发展,对定位算法的要求越来越高,包括实时性、鲁棒性和抗干扰能力。
全球定位系统(GPS)定位原理,1.GPS定位原理基于测量接收到的卫星信号传播时间,通过计算信号传播时间差来确定用户位置2.GPS系统由地面控制站、卫星和用户接收机组成,卫星发射的信号包含了卫星的精确位置和时间信息3.GPS定位的精度受到信号传播时间测量误差、大气折射和卫星钟误差等因素的影响定位算法原理分析,惯性导航系统(INS)定位原理,1.INS定位原理基于惯性测量单元(IMU)测量的加速度和角速度,通过积分运动方程计算位置和姿态2.INS系统在无外部信号干扰的情况下,可以长时间自主工作,适用于需要高自主性的应用场景3.然而,INS系统存在积分漂移问题,需要通过其他传感器数据校正来提高定位精度多传感器融合定位算法,1.多传感器融合定位算法结合了不同类型传感器的数据,如GPS、IMU、雷达和摄像头,以提高定位的准确性和鲁棒性2.融合算法可以采用卡尔曼滤波、粒子滤波或其他优化算法,对传感器数据进行加权处理3.随着传感器技术的进步,多传感器融合定位算法正朝着更加智能和自适应的方向发展定位算法原理分析,定位算法的实时性优化,1.定位算法的实时性是自动驾驶和实时交通管理的关键要求,要求算法在短时间内完成定位计算。
2.通过优化算法结构、减少计算复杂度和提高数据处理效率,可以实现定位算法的实时性优化3.硬件加速和并行计算技术的发展为实时定位算法的实现提供了技术支持定位算法的抗干扰能力,1.定位算法在复杂环境下容易受到电磁干扰、多径效应等因素的影响,导致定位精度下降2.通过设计抗干扰算法,如信号处理、滤波和干扰识别技术,可以提高定位算法的抗干扰能力3.随着人工智能和机器学习技术的发展,可以利用这些技术对干扰信号进行识别和抑制,进一步提高定位算法的鲁棒性感知与定位技术融合,车辆感知与定位算法,感知与定位技术融合,多传感器融合技术,1.通过集成多种传感器(如雷达、摄像头、激光雷达等)的数据,实现车辆对周围环境的全面感知2.利用传感器融合算法,如卡尔曼滤波、粒子滤波等,提高感知数据的准确性和鲁棒性3.融合技术有助于克服单一传感器在特定环境下的局限性,提升车辆在复杂场景下的适应能力时空数据融合,1.结合车辆的位置、速度、时间等时空信息,进行数据融合处理,以实现高精度的定位和路径规划2.时空数据融合技术能够有效减少数据冗余,提高数据处理效率,降低计算成本3.在动态环境中,时空数据融合有助于实时更新车辆状态,确保导航和决策的准确性。
感知与定位技术融合,深度学习在感知与定位中的应用,1.深度学习模型,如卷积神经网络(CNN)和循环神经网络(RNN),在图像识别、语义分割等方面表现出色,被广泛应用于车辆感知2.深度学习技术能够从海量数据中自动学习特征,提高感知系统的智能化水平3.结合深度学习与传感器融合,可以实现更高级别的自动驾驶功能,如自动泊车、车道保持等定位算法优化与改进,1.研究和发展新的定位算法,如高斯-牛顿迭代法、非线性最小二乘法等,以提高定位精度和稳定性2.通过优化算法参数和调整算法结构,减少定位过程中的误差和漂移3.结合实时数据处理和反馈机制,实现定位算法的动态调整和优化感知与定位技术融合,定位系统与通信技术结合,1.将定位系统与通信技术相结合,如蜂窝网络、Wi-Fi等,实现车辆与基础设施之间的信息交互2.通信技术的融合有助于提高定位系统的实时性和可靠性,减少延迟和误差3.结合车联网(V2X)技术,实现车辆之间的协同定位,提高整个交通系统的安全性融合技术在智能交通系统中的应用,1.感知与定位技术的融合在智能交通系统中扮演着关键角色,如交通流量监控、事故预警等2.融合技术有助于实现交通管理的智能化,提高道路使用效率,减少拥堵。
3.结合大数据分析和人工智能技术,融合技术能够为城市交通规划提供有力支持,促进可持续发展算法性能优化策略,车辆感知与定位算法,算法性能优化策略,1.通过算法结构优化,减少计算量,提高处理速度例如,采用近似算法或快速算法替代复杂度较高的传统算法2.引入并行计算和分布式计算技术,实现算法的并行化处理,提高计算效率3.利用深度学习等生成模型,自动优化算法参数,实现算法的自适应调整数据预处理优化,1.对输入数据进行去噪、归一化等预处理操作,提高数据质量,减少算法对噪声的敏感度2.采用数据增强技术,如旋转、缩放、翻转等,增加数据多样性,提升算法的泛化能力3.利用数据挖掘技术,从大量数据中提取有效特征,减少算法输入维度,降低计算复杂度算法复杂度优化,算法性能优化策略,模型结构优化,1.设计轻量级模型结构,如使用深度可分离卷积等,减少模型参数数量,降低计算资源消耗2.采用网络剪枝技术,去除冗余连接,提高模型效率3.引入注意力机制,使模型能够关注到最重要的特征,提高定位精度算法鲁棒性优化,1.通过引入鲁棒性训练方法,如对抗训练,提高算法对噪声和异常值的容忍度2.优化损失函数,使其能够更好地反映定位误差,提高算法的收敛速度和定位精度。
3.结合多种传感器数据,如摄像头、雷达等,提高算法在复杂环境下的鲁棒性算法性能优化策略,实时性能优化,1.采用多线程或异步处理技术,实现算法的实时处理,满足实时性要求2.优化算法的内存使用,减少内存占用,提高处理速度3.采用动态调整策略,根据实时任务需求动态调整算法参数,确保实时性能跨领域算法融合,1.将不同领域的先进算法和技术进行融合,如将图像处理算法与雷达数据处理算法相结合,提高定位精度2.利用迁移学习技术,将其他领域的成功模型应用于车辆感知与定位,减少从头开始训练的复杂性3.开发跨领域算法,如融合深度学习与强化学习,实现更智能的车辆感知与定位实时数据处理方法,车辆感知与定位算法,实时数据处理方法,数据预处理技术,1.数据清洗:包括去除噪声、填补缺失值、消除异常值等,确保数据质量,为后续处理提供可靠基础2.数据转换:将原始数据转换为适合算法处理的形式,如归一化、标准化等,提高数据处理效率3.特征提取:从原始数据中提取有价值的信息,降低数据维度,减少计算量,同时保留关键信息实时数据采集与传输,1.传感器融合:通过多源传感器数据融合,提高数据采集的准确性和实时性,如GPS、IMU等2.高速传输:采用高速网络技术,确保数据实时传输,降低数据延迟,提高处理速度。
3.数据压缩:对采集到的数据进行压缩,减少数据传输量,降低带宽消耗,提高传输效率实时数据处理方法,实时数据存储与管理,1.分布式存储:采用分布式存储系统,提高数据存储的可靠性和扩展性,满足大规模数据存储需求2.数据索引:建立高效的数据索引机制,加快数据检索速度,降低查询延迟3.数据备份:定期对数据进行备份,防止数据丢失,确保数据安全实时数据处理算法,1.线性规划:通过线性规划算法,优化数据处理流程,提高处理效率,如动态窗口算法2.深度学习:利用深度学习模型,实现实时数据的高效处理,如卷积神经网络(CNN)、循环神经网络(RNN)等3.机器学习:运用机器学习算法,对实时数据进行分类、预测等任务,提高数据处理智能化水平实时数据处理方法,1.实时图表:通过实时图表展示数据变化趋势,便于用户快速了解数据动态2.数据地图:利用地理信息系统(GIS)技术,将数据可视化在地图上,直观展示地理位置信息3.交互式界面:设计交互式数据可视化界面,使用户能够与数据互动,提高数据处理效率实时数据处理系统架构,1.云计算平台:采用云计算平台,实现数据处理资源的弹性扩展和高效利用2.分布式架构:采用分布式架构,提高系统处理能力,降低单点故障风险。
3.微服务架构:采用微服务架构,实现系统模块化,提高系统可维护性和可扩展性实时数据可视化,数据融合算法研究,车辆感知与定位算法,数据融合算法研究,多传感器数据融合技术,1.集成多种传感器数据以提高车辆感知的准确性和鲁棒性例如,结合雷达、摄像头和激光雷达(LiDAR)数据,可以提供更全面的周围环境信息2.研究不同的融合算法,如卡尔曼滤波、粒子滤波和自适应滤波,以优化数据处理流程3.探索深度学习在数据融合中的应用,通过神经网络模型实现传感器数据的智能融合,提高融合效果的实时性和适应性信息一致性处理,1.针对来自不同传感器的数据,研究信息一致性处理方法,以解决时间同步、空间对齐和数据格式统一等问题2.采用同步滤波器、数据插值和坐标变换等技术,确保融合数据的准确性和一致性3.分析和评估不同一致性处理方法对车辆定位和导航性能的影响,优化算法以提高系统整体性能数据融合算法研究,多源数据融合策略,1.设计针对不同应用场景的多源数据融合策略,如城市道路和高速公路的融合策略,以满足不同环境下的感知需求2.研究基于特征层次和决策层次的融合策略,以实现高效的数据处理和信息提取3.探索动态融合策略,根据实时环境变化调整融合权重,提高系统的适应性和灵活性。
数据融合与决策融合,1.将数据融合与决策融合相结合,通过融合后的数据优化决策过程,提高车辆行为的预测准确性和安全性2.研究基于融合数据的决策模型,如行为预测、路径规划和紧急情况响应,以提高车辆的智能化水平3.分析决策融合算法在。
